Jar$ for Jamaa Letu 2018!!
This year's labels for the annual 'jar' fundraiser to support the orphanages of Jamaa Letu in Lubumbashi, in the Democratic Republic of Congo are now available. Directions are provided for local churches and individuals seeking to support this important, life-giving, ministry.

The Real Easter is…
In a letter to his church, Rev. Mike Graef names some of the disappointment many feel celebrating Easter in these COVID-19 times.
While sharing this disappointment, he reminds us that the true Easter experience doesn't require these things.
Talking with your church about General Conference 2019
As the special session of General Conference grows closer, it is expected that the curiosity of the average United Methodist will grow. Rev. Debbie Sperry shares one way she is working to keep her members well-informed and engaged in conversation.
